Fossil is a simple, high-reliability, distributed software configuration management system with these advanced features: Project Management, in addition to doing distributed version control like Git and Mercurial, Fossil also supports bug tracking, wiki, forum, chat, and technotes. Built-in Web Interface, Fossil has a built-in, themeable, extensible, and intuitive web interface with a rich variety of information pages (examples) promoting situational awareness. All-in-one - Fossil is a single self-contained, stand-alone executable. To install, simply download a precompiled binary for Linux, Mac, or Windows and put it on your $PATH. Self-host Friendly - Stand up a project website in minutes using a variety of techniques. Fossil is CPU and memory efficient. Most projects can be hosted comfortably on a $5/month VPS or a Raspberry Pi. You can also set up an automatic GitHub mirror. Simple Networking - Fossil uses ordinary HTTPS (or SSH if you prefer) for network communications.

Git is a free and open source distributed version control system designed to handle everything from small to very large projects with speed and efficiency. Git is easy to learn and has a tiny footprint with lightning fast performance. It outclasses SCM tools like Subversion, CVS, Perforce, and ClearCase with features like cheap local branching, convenient staging areas, and multiple workflows. Pros & Cons from Real Users

Pros

  • * One simple executable file contains all functionality. * Highly consistent and easy to learn command set. * Highly cross platform -- has been even compiled to run in a Raspberry Pi. * Runs even in very simple hosting, requiring only CGI support to run properly. * Easy to set one-way mirroring to Git * Supports Markdown, as well as Pikchr for graphics that can be represented as easily versionable text. * "Mini-Github" functionality out of the box.

Cons

  • * Some of its design decision (e. g. no rebase by design) scares Git users.
